extension FloatingUITestWindow {
// pass taps through window if not in stack view
override func hitTest(_ point: CGPoint, with event: UIEvent?) -> UIView? {
let hitView = super.hitTest(point, with: event)
return (hitView == stackView || hitView?.superview == stackView) ? hitView : nil
}
}
